Overseas markets as OPPO's growth engine

Overseas markets have become the growth engine for OPPO. Currently, the company operates in over 70 countries and regions, with more than 300,000 retail spaces worldwide. OPPO now ranks No. 4 globally in smartphone shipments, and overseas shipments account for approximately 60% of its total volume.

Southeast Asia remains a core market for OPPO, where the brand holds the top position. Newly established markets in 2024, such as Brazil and Argentina, underscore OPPO's commitment to expanding in Latin America. Now OPPO ranks NO.5 with a 62% year-on-year growth in Latin America.[1]

OPPO's ambitions of globalization extend beyond smartphones as it evolves into a comprehensive global technology company. With a diverse product portfolio that includes internet services—engaging 700 million ColorOS users worldwide[2]—and a growing lineup of IoT products, OPPO is dedicated to expanding its presence in global markets.

Strengthening local connections through retail, manufacturing, and cultural engagement


A significant part of OPPO's globalization success comes from its commitment to connect with local communities.

With the goal of resonating with people and understanding their unique cultures, OPPO partners with Discovery Channel this year to launch the "Culture in a Shot" initiatives, celebrating cultural diversity through OPPO imaging technology. To date, over 330 million people worldwide have been inspired by these cultural images and stories.

OPPO's understanding of local culture is also evident in its retail strategy. As part of its retail 3.0 Pro upgrading plan with a $60 million investment, OPPO integrates the local culture into its retail space to create a welcoming and familiar environment for customers. In Indonesia, for example, OPPO stores feature coffee corners with locally sourced coffee.

To ensure reliable quality for local consumers, OPPO is not just sold globally but also made globally. With manufacturing centers in 8 countries, OPPO's local production capabilities enable it to efficiently meet regional market demands while strengthening connections with local communities and economies.

About OPPO

OPPO is a leading global smart device brand. Since the launch of its first mobile phone - "Smiley Face" - in 2008, OPPO has been in relentless pursuit of the perfect synergy of aesthetic satisfaction and innovative technology. Today, OPPO provides a wide range of smart devices spearheaded by the Find and Reno series. Beyond devices, OPPO also provides its users with ColorOS operating system and internet services. OPPO has footprints in more than 70 countries and regions, with more than 40,000 employees dedicated to creating a better life for customers around the world.
